Suppressing Rejection Using an External Trigger
(Reject 1)
When the suppress-rejection function is enabled, you can manually suppress the reject
device. This is useful when you are conducting a Quality Test or other manual test of the
detector's ability to detect contamination. For this function to work, you must do both of
the following.
•
Hardwire the button or other triggering device to one of the inputs (Input 3–6) on
the detector's wiring board (the physical set-up), see page 289.
•
Tell the detector which input is being used (the logical set-up). For more
information, about assigning inputs and logical set-up procedures, see page 222.
1) Make sure the suppression external trigger menu is highlighted.
Suppression External Trigger
2) Press the Go button and a check mark appears. The suppress-rejection external
trigger function is now enabled.
Suppression External Trigger
3) Press the Back button to exit the menu.
